The fitness industry is growing by leaps and bounds in the United States, with more than 60 million of us owning a gym membership. James Barber hopes to capitalize on this trend.The 39-year-old trainer from Concord has just moved into the Montclair Village space vacated last month by the home goods store Mix. Barber’s own ‘mix’ of clients includes several who started with him when he was part of a collective of trainers at The Institute on Mountain Boulevard.

“I love the feel of the Montclair vibe; I like the people here,” says Barber. He says the community here doesn’t just want a hard workout but a little bit more.
